The New Norm Edition of the Her World Beauty Awards, now in its 20th year, showcases 143 winners, from maskne serums to budge-proof foundation­s for mask-wear, and even anti-hair loss treatments to tackle pandemic stress.

-

Wouldn’t you agree that 2020 was quite a year? It not only overturned everything we knew about life in general, it changed the way we approached beauty, from skincare to makeup. With many staying in and working from home, the big focus was on skincare – maskne products as well as those to keep skin clear, healthy and strong.

Makeup wasn’t completely ignored, although the focus moved to long-wear and budge-proof formulas that helped combat heat and humidity from mask-wear.

This year, we introduce haircare to the awards mix, adding to perennial skin faves like antiageing and brightenin­g serums, eye creams and moisturise­rs.

Together with our panel of judges, we put hundreds of skincare, makeup and hair products to the test, making up more than 12,700 hours of testing in all. The 143 winners that made the cut are presented in these pages.

From a beauty brand with a cause, to extensivel­y researched, sciencebac­ked products, to innovative formulatio­ns, and even a memorable virtual pop-up, here are the top moments of the year that got the Her World team talking.

MOST INNOVATIVE SKIN ESSENCE

A bi-phase essence containing grapeseed oil, French beech bud extract and glycolic acid, it harnesses the benefits of enzymes – which Lancome scientists have been studying for 30 years.

Enzymes create and speed up the chemical reactions in skin cells, helping with regenerati­on, hydration, regulating the amount of melanin produced, and even getting rid of melanin-laden skin cells. The result: a smoother and brighter complexion.

The design-patented whisk combines the two phases by generating micro bubbles for an optimal blend as you shake the bottle. It costs $148.

BEST SG CLEANBEAUT­Y BRAND

Glowfully started with the goal of omitting the top four controvers­ial ingredient­s in its products – parabens, phthalates, sulphates and formaldehy­de. But it’s gone beyond and now excludes other questionab­le ingredient­s, such as triclosan, artificial fragrance and PEGs (polyethyle­ne glycols).

Our fave: Its signature H20 Jelly Mask is a zerowaste product – after use, the mask can be melted in warm water into an essence that can be used on the face and body. Prices start from $38.90.

MOST INNOVATIVE SERUM

It’s a bi-phase hydrating serum that you can customise according to your skin’s needs. Want more hydration? Shake the bottle a few more times to mix the rose-based oil and water actives really well, so that the smaller bubbles absorb quickly to deeply hydrate skin. For a dewy complexion, shake the bottle gently – the larger bubbles mean the oil actives stay on the skin’s surface to give a glowy sheen. It costs $95.

MOST SUSTAINABL­E BEAUTY BRAND

Chantecail­le has championed sustainabl­e beauty since day one. The brand cultivates plant stem cells in the lab, which provide a limitless supply of active ingredient­s – which means that both land and water are freed up for farming crops for food. The New York-based French beauty brand also supports animal conservati­on efforts. So doing your part to stop global warming can be as easy as applying a Chantecail­le lipstick.
